Ingredients of Coconut laddu
- Prepare 150 gms of desiccated coconut.
- Prepare 1/2 tin of condensed milk.
- It's 1/2 tsp of cardamom powder.
It has the aroma of roasted coconut. Grated coconut and keep it ready. You can use desiccated coconut also. Heat a tsp of ghee and fry the grated coconut slightly.
Coconut laddu instructions
- Take a heavy bottom wok add desiccated coconut in it roast it on a low medium flame for a minute..
- Add condensed milk and cardamom powder stir continuously on low flame cook it for 4-5 minutes. turn off the flame..
- Let it cool. Make laddu of your desired shape and size. Coat it with coconut..
- It's ready to eat..
